NLP

(Neuro-Linguistic Programming)

NLP is a sensory communication model and an alternative approach to psychotherapy that uses language and communication to produce personal change. It was developed in the 1970s by co-creators Richard Bandler and linguist John Grinder, after studying and then modelling three key outstanding therapists of their time. Notably these were Milton Erickson (Clinical Hypnosis), Virginia Satir (Family Systems Therapy) and Fritz Perls (Gestalt Therapy).

NLP has grown popular in many areas of life other than that of therapy from where it originated and today its models and tools have been used widely in advertising, sales, business communication, management training, teaching, executive coaching and motivational seminars.

Like Clinical Hypnotherapy and EFT, it works positively to alter the beliefs that we have in our unconscious minds that may be hindering us from health, happiness and reaching our full potential. It helps to uncover our limitations and find new ways to be and act in the world that ultimately will give us even greater feelings of control, love and security.
